Output e26131781e650faa695590a5b5839e06bf610ab38e355dfee0ef2c3c96d9f82f:69

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 38f4b52cce80ea83d094ea3e3e6f244cef3465d320b6655d80827da6e0a693c5
address
bc1p8r6t2txwsr4g85y5aglrumeyfnhngewnyzmx2hvqsf76dc9xj0zs66f2eq
transaction
e26131781e650faa695590a5b5839e06bf610ab38e355dfee0ef2c3c96d9f82f
spent
true